Subject: Morvane Licensing Dispute — Status

Team,

Quick update for sales leads. Morvane Systems continues to contest our right to bundle the Calyx module with Fernhold deployments. Their counsel sent a revised claim last week; ours believes it overreaches but expects months of back-and-forth. Until resolved, do not quote Calyx bundles to new prospects without legal review. Existing contracts are unaffected. Keep messaging neutral if customers ask. Our fallback position, should talks collapse, is summarised below.

internal memo for hahif-yafof: Headcount on the Quenwyn team goes from 7 to 120 by the end of October. Gross margin on Quenwyn came in at 15 percent against a plan of 10 percent.

## Deploying Ledgerpeek

Hey plugin folks — Ledgerpeek ships as one container, and your plugins load from the mounted plugins directory at startup. Hot reload isn't a thing yet, so bounce the container after dropping in a build. The viewer is read-only against the audit store; plugins can't write, full stop. Keep your plugin manifests versioned or the loader will skip them. A fresh deploy boots with these configuration values.

settings of kajep-kajop:
OLIDOR_LOG_LEVEL=info
OLIDOR_METRICS_HOST=metrics.olidor.norvacorp.corp
OLIDOR_POOL_SIZE=4

**Handover: template rendering performance**

Welcome aboard. The Inkmarrow renderer was slow because partials were recompiled per request; I added a compiled-template cache and precomputed helper lookups. Please keep the cache size conservative until you've profiled the holiday load. The benchmark harness lives in the `perf` folder. The renderer currently runs with the settings listed below.

service settings:
[casax]
port = 6379
team = rusir
host = casax.zemvarhq.corp
region = outer-4
access_code = ac_9808ce
timeout_ms = 1500

Subject: ReminderSpool handover

Hey Priya — handing over release duty for the clinic reminder job before the eng sync. Build's green, the Tuesday batch went out clean, nothing weird in the retry queue. Only thing you need from me is signing access so Thursday's push doesn't stall. Here's the key:

rollout seal: bky4_CTqF